Understanding the Pricing of Chain Link Fences


When it comes to securing your property, a chain link fence is often one of the most economical and efficient solutions available. However, consumers often find themselves wondering about the factors that influence the pricing of chain link fences. In this article, we'll explore the typical pricing structure, factors affecting cost, and tips for making an informed purchase.


Pricing Structure


The cost of chain link fences typically varies based on several components, including the height, gauge, coating type, and installation. On average, you can expect to pay between $10 to $20 per linear foot for material alone. This estimate can fluctuate depending on the aforementioned factors.


1. Height Common heights for chain link fences range from 3 feet to 12 feet. The taller the fence, the more material is required, leading to higher costs. For instance, a 4-foot fence might cost around $10 per foot, whereas a 6-foot fence could be around $15 per foot.


2. Gauge The durability of a chain link fence largely depends on the gauge of the wire used. Common gauges range from 11 to 6, where a lower number indicates thicker wire. Thicker wire is more expensive, but offers increased strength and longevity, making it worthwhile for situations requiring higher security.


3. Coating Types Chain link fences come in various finishes, such as galvanized (silver), vinyl (black, green, or brown), and other coatings. While galvanized fences are the least expensive, coated options add a level of aesthetic appeal and corrosion resistance, which may be essential for certain environments. Prices can increase by $1 to $3 per linear foot for coated fences.


Installation Costs

In addition to the costs of materials, homeowners must consider installation expenses, which can significantly impact the total project cost. Professional installation can range from $5 to $15 per foot. Factors like terrain, pre-existing structures, and local labor rates will influence these costs. DIY enthusiasts can save on labor by opting to install the fence independently; however, they should consider necessary tools, time, and expertise required for a proper installation.


Additional Considerations


Several other factors can influence the overall pricing of a chain link fence


- Gates If your property requires access points, gates can be a significant addition to the cost. Basic swing gates can range from $100 to $300, depending on size and material. More complex gate types, such as automatic gates, can escalate costs even further.


- Accessories Items like tension wire, barb wire, or privacy slats can enhance the functionality and appearance of your fence but will add to the overall costs.


- Permits Before installation, check with local regulations regarding necessary permits or zoning laws that could impact your project. Failing to adhere to these can lead to fines or additional costs down the line.
